Projects

Accent Ace

Accent Ace is an AI-powered software that generates text for users and records their voice to analyze their pronunciation. The goal of this project is to enable users to improve their pronunciation skills independently.

FastAPINext.jsDockerGCPFirebase
Hyperpersonalisation Backend

A banking backend made using Django and Django REST Framework for building a hypersonalised middleware that can be integrated with existing banking app at IIT Delhi.

DjangoDjango REST Framework
Movie Recommender

A Django-based movie recommendation system built with Item-Item Collaborative Filtering and Content-Based Filtering with UI inspiration from Amazon Prime Video.

DjangoKaggleRecommendation SystemsScikit-LearnPandasNumPy
College CMS

A Content Management System for colleges built with Laravel, PHP, MySQL, and JavaScript. It features an admin dashboard for content management and multiple user roles controlled access.

LaravelPHPMySQLJavaScriptNginxBootstrap
Listen Bot

A Telegram bot that will download and convert YouTube videos into MP3 files by taking the provided YouTube link as input.

Telegram BotYouTube APIPython
Theyyam Classifier API

A Django REST API integrated with a TensorFlow image classification model. Built using Django Rest Framework, and deployed on an Azure VM using Nginx for a research project.

DjangoDjango Rest FrameworkTensorFlowAzure VMNginx